Interpro abstract (IPR020547):

This entry represents the C-terminal long alpha-helix domain of ATPase subunits delta (in mitochondrial ATPase) or epsilon (in bacteria or chloroplast ATPase) [ (PUBMED:9331422) ].

The interaction site of subunit C of the F0 complex with the delta or epsilon subunit of the F1 complex may be important for connecting the rotor of F1 (gamma subunit) to the rotor of F0 (C subunit) [ (PUBMED:12887009) ]. In bacterial species, the delta subunit is the equivalent of the Oligomycin sensitive subunit (OSCP, IPR000711 ) in metazoans. The C-terminal domain of the epsilon subunit appears to act as an inhibitor of ATPase activity [ (PUBMED:16707672) ].
